There are two types of bladder in the MC21/28 shocks; a large one, which makes charging with gas extremely difficult, and a small one, that makes charging with gas... extremely difficult! LOL

We make our own custom end-caps (sometimes with a larger capacity that stock), rather than modifying the OEM steel cap, but that should work equally well.



I would personally use a bolt-on type valve over a threaded one, as there's not much metal to play with. I wouldn't weld one in either, as I would expect it would probably distort.
